Original equipment - flawed design by Nikon, but there is no better option. I broke the original one by quickly dropping into a deep kneel with the lens (attached to a body) hanging from my shoulder. Protected the lens from damage. Lost the replacement in a crowd with the 80-200 (with body) slung on one shoulder and a 200-400 (on a body) on the other. The quick-thread-and-Click design is not very secure, so, on the replacement, I started using two small pieces of gaff tape to secure the hood to the lens.

I've broken two of these in the past five years on my Nikon 80-200mm f/2.8 and in both instances the lens has survived without any damage. The plastic is thick but it flexes just enough to absorb impact without passing it on to the lens. It also holds up well when I duct tape plastic waterproofing to my lens and camera - the tape residue always washes off, leaving no marks. I give it four stars only because I think the price is a few dollars too high.
